M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
considers
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ses.
The latest
improvements in
online education are empowering
humans
in all parts of the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
These MOOC classes are
almost always free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are many
subjects that
elearning institutions
are considering
now that distance learning technology is
improving so fast.
How can participants
certify that
the training provided by these
MOOC classes is
passable?
How can organizations
make sure that
instructors are properly credentialed
to teach massively open online courses?
What business strategies are being used by
institutions like
Udacity to conduct these massively open online courses?
What teaching practices and assessment strategies are in use today?
How can organizations
manage issues like
low
learner motivation and high
learner dropout rates?
As digital elearning technology becomes more
available there is a
developing
need
to grasp how
MOOC classes are being conducted.
Scholars
and numerous other
stakeholders
want
to better comprehend
the outcomes of these
exciting new open educational
initiatives.
Intellectuals want
to gain an understanding of how
these massively open online courses
can be made better.
To satisfy this
demand for
knowledge
MOOCs and Open Education
offers a critical analysis of
these MOOC courses and other open educational issues.
This intriguing new book
also examines the
controversies associated with
MOOC classes and open education resources (OER).
